HOST: That sounds fascinating. For our listeners who might be new to this topic, can you explain how social psychology influences financial decision-making?
GUEST: Absolutely. Social psychology plays a significant role in shaping our financial choices. Our emotions, social norms, and cognitive biases all impact how we make financial decisions. By understanding these psychological factors, we can design more effective financial education programs and develop targeted financial products that cater to individual needs.
